Creating an Inventory Item:

“Inventory”, “Inventory Items”, “+Inventory Item”

Note: When setting up an inventory item, you must have Ingredient Categories, Storage Locations, Vendors, and In House Units created


Select a Category for the item


Select a Primary Storage location for the item


Select a Vendor


Select an Inventory Unit


Select a Purchase Unit



Fill Out the Following:

Quantity = Number of Items in Each Purchase Unit

Price = Cost of Purchase Unit

Yield % = How Much of Each Purchase Unit You Will Use

Price/Unit = This Will Be Automatically Calculated


Last add your conversion
